FaceTime video/audio broken by Private Internet Access VPN client on Mac
For about a year FaceTime on my MacBook "connected" fine, the call would ring, both sides would say Connected, but neither side saw video or heard audio. It would just show each user’s initials in circles.
After some debugging with Claude (agents turn out to be great at this sort of thing) I tracked it down to Private Internet Access’s client which includes a SplitTunnelProxyExtension system extension for intercepting traffic.
The fix: System Settings → General → Login Items & Extensions → Network Extensions → toggle SplitTunnelProxyExtension off.
After that FaceTime worked correctly.
It looks like technically this is not a PIA bug, but known Apple bug in NETransparentProxyProvider.
